WebMar 26, 2024 · Fast Reactors: Fast reactors do not moderate the speed of neutrons; unlike thermal reactors, which slow neutrons down, fast reactors allow neutrons to stay at the speed at which they emerge from the fission reactions. In some cases, they can use uranium fuel more efficiently than thermal reactors.
